数字人主播,也称为虚拟主播或ai主播,是通过计算机图形学、人工智能和机器学习技术实现的。它们可以模拟真人主播的形象、声音和行为,为用户提供更加逼真和互动的体验。以下是制作数字人主播的步骤:
1. 设计虚拟形象:首先,需要为数字人主播设计一个虚拟形象。这包括选择角色的外观、服装、发型等元素。可以使用3d建模软件(如blender、maya、3ds max等)来创建角色的模型,然后使用纹理贴图和动画来赋予角色生动的表现力。
2. 录制或采集声音:为了让数字人主播能够说话,需要录制或采集主播的声音。可以使用麦克风或其他音频设备来捕捉声音,然后将音频文件导入到音频编辑软件(如audacity、adobe audition等)中进行处理。
3. 编写脚本:根据需求,可以为数字人主播编写相应的脚本。脚本可以是简单的文本命令,也可以是复杂的程序逻辑。通过编程,可以实现数字人主播的各种动作和交互。
4. 训练ai算法:为了让数字人主播能够模仿真人主播的行为,需要训练ai算法。这包括对数字人主播的动作进行分类和识别,以及根据输入的命令生成相应的动作。可以使用深度学习框架(如tensorflow、pytorch等)来实现这一过程。
5. 集成到平台:将数字人主播集成到直播平台或应用程序中。这通常涉及到与平台的api接口对接,以便数字人主播能够接收并执行用户的指令。
6. 测试和优化:在集成到平台后,需要进行测试以确保数字人主播的稳定性和性能。根据测试结果,对数字人主播进行优化,以提高其表现力和用户体验。
7. 发布和推广:一旦数字人主播经过测试和优化,就可以发布到直播平台或应用程序中,供用户使用。可以通过社交媒体、广告等方式进行推广,吸引更多的用户关注和使用数字人主播。
总之,制作数字人主播需要多个环节的协作,包括设计、录制、编程、训练、集成和测试等。通过这些步骤,可以创造出一个具有高度逼真性和互动性的虚拟主播,为用户提供全新的娱乐体验。